Prerequisite:

All electrical contacts must be equipped with a connection point [Connection point].

For components that have already been classified by the manufacturer according to ECLASS, the information can be mapped to the CNS classification. Otherwise, the 3D data in PARTsolutions (connection points classified as electrical connections) must be provided with additional information from the data sheet.

CADENAS supports a certain subset of the connection properties ( Electrical Connection class) defined in ECLASS ADVANCED, which can be extended at any time.

The following illustration shows (framed in red) the currently available connection properties (Electrical Connection = CNS_CP|4|3 ) called up under PARTproject -> Extras menu -> Class systems: Edit. [Class systems: edit...].

Class system CNS -> Filter connection points [Connection points] -> Insertion Point -> Electrical -> Electrical Connection
